How to Identify Font Name, Size and Color on a Website using Chrome Extension

December 14, 2016 DbAppWeb Admin

When you visit different websites or blogs sometimes these attract you because of their clarity and neatness of text display. People visiting your website or blog may be of different age groups so you need to choose a standard font color, font family, and font size and these must be compatible with all Internet Browsers. If you are using the Google Chrome browser then you can use the WhatFont Chrome extension to get font details without going to the source code of the web page. WhatFont easily identifies the font family, font size and font color of the text being used on any web page.

Once installed click the whatFont button at the top right corner to activate it. Then you can simply hover your mouse on any text you want to inspect. You can also click near a text to fetch complete details of it like font family, size, line height and color.
